X-CUBE is a compact X-ray CCD camera designed for non-
destructive inspection. Using a general-purpose CCD chip
mounted in a rugged but lightweight camera head, X-CUBE makes
X-ray imaging as easy as handling ordinary CCD cameras.
There are two different models in the X-CUBE family - the H8480
and H8481. The H8480 uses a 2/3-inch CCD coupled to a large-
diameter tapered FOP. This FOP is coated with CsI, the next
generation of X-ray scintillators, and offers a large effective area of
25 mm diameter and a resolution of 8 Lp/mm. The H8481 uses a
straight type FOP instead of the large FOP, achieving a high
resolution of 13 Lp/mm.
This easy-to-use, compact and lightweight X-ray CCD camera will
let you create totally new types of non-destructive inspections.

RELATED PRODUCTS
GFOS (Fiber optic plate coated with X-ray scintillator)
IStructure
The FOS is an optical device for X-ray imaging, fabricated by
coating an X-ray scintillator material over a fiber optic plate con-
sisting of tens of million glass fibers each a few micrometers in
diameter. The FOS provides higher sensitivity and resolution
than currently used sensitized paper films and also allows real-
time digital radiography when directly coupled to a commercial-
ly available CCD. The fiber optic plate used in the FOS has
excellent X-ray absorption characteristics, so that X-rays pene-
trating the X-ray scintillator and directly entering the CCD are
minimized to less than 1 %. This protects the CCD from the
deterioration and increased noise caused by X-ray irradiation,
assuring a long service life and maintaining high image quality.
Various sizes and shapes of FOS are available to meet your
particular needs, including tapered FOP types.
